Board Sets Tuition, Housing Fees During March Meeting

Part of an overall strategy to address an expected $5.4 million decline in state funding for Fiscal Year 2019, the University of Central Missouri Board of Governors is putting a 2.1 percent increase in base resident undergraduate and graduate tuition on the books in preparation for the fall 2018 semester.

Governor's FY19 Budget Recommendations Include 7.72 Percent Reduction in Funding for Public Universities

In a press conference Monday, Jan. 22, Missouri Gov. Eric Greitens announced his Fiscal Year 2019 budget recommendations calling for across-the-board cuts of 7.72 in gross appropriations for post-secondary education. His recommendation was part of a total reduction for higher education of $62.8 million.
